MySQL是廣泛應(yīng)用的數(shù)據(jù)庫管理系統(tǒng),但是有時(shí)候我們需要完全刪除其中的某個文件,包括數(shù)據(jù)文件、配置文件等。該操作對于數(shù)據(jù)庫運(yùn)行正常以及系統(tǒng)安全性具有一定的影響,所以請務(wù)必謹(jǐn)慎操作,建議在操作前備份相關(guān)數(shù)據(jù)。
下面是刪除MySQL文件的步驟:
1. 停止MySQL服務(wù) $ sudo systemctl stop mysql 2. 刪除相關(guān)文件 $ sudo rm -rf /var/lib/mysql/{database_name} # 刪除數(shù)據(jù)庫文件 $ sudo rm -rf /etc/mysql/my.cnf # 刪除配置文件 3. 刪除MySQL用戶和組 # 在/etc/group文件里刪除mysql相關(guān)行 $ sudo vi /etc/group # 在/etc/passwd文件里刪除mysql相關(guān)行 $ sudo vi /etc/passwd 4. 在MySQL的授權(quán)表中刪除相關(guān)信息(可選) # 登錄MySQL $ mysql -u root -p # 刪除相關(guān)信息 $ DROP USER '{username}'@'{hostname}'; $ DROP DATABASE `{database_name}`; 5. 重新啟動MySQL服務(wù) $ sudo systemctl start mysql
以上是完全刪除MySQL文件的步驟,大家在操作時(shí)一定要注意刪錯文件,以免引起不必要的損失。如果您想重新安裝MySQL請參考相關(guān)教程。